Write the word equation for it.<\/p>\n\n\n\n<p><strong><mark style=\"background-color:rgba(0, 0, 0, 0)\" class=\"has-inline-color has-vivid-cyan-blue-color\">The Correct Answer and Explanation is:<\/mark><\/strong><\/p>\n\n\n\n<p><strong>Answer:<\/strong><br><strong>Aerobic respiration<\/strong> is the process by which cells break down glucose in the presence of oxygen to produce energy.<\/p>\n\n\n\n<p><strong>Word equation for aerobic respiration:<\/strong><br><strong>Glucose + Oxygen \u2192 Carbon dioxide + Water + Energy<\/strong><\/p>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n\n\n<p><strong>Explanation<\/strong><br>Aerobic respiration is a biological process that takes place in the cells of most plants, animals, and many microorganisms. It allows organisms to convert the chemical energy stored in glucose into a usable form of energy called adenosine triphosphate, or ATP. This process requires oxygen, which is why it is referred to as &#8220;aerobic&#8221; \u2014 a term that means &#8220;with air&#8221; or &#8220;with oxygen.&#8221;<\/p>\n\n\n\n<p>The overall word equation for aerobic respiration is:<\/p>\n\n\n\n<p><strong>Glucose + Oxygen \u2192 Carbon dioxide + Water + Energy<\/strong><\/p>\n\n\n\n<p>Glucose, which is a simple sugar, is the fuel used by cells. Oxygen is needed for the chemical reactions that break down glucose molecules. This breakdown happens inside tiny cell structures called mitochondria. As the glucose is broken down, carbon atoms from the glucose combine with oxygen to form carbon dioxide, which is then released from the body through breathing. At the same time, hydrogen atoms from the glucose molecules combine with oxygen to produce water.<\/p>\n\n\n\n<p>The energy released from this process is stored in ATP molecules. Cells then use this energy to perform essential tasks such as muscle contraction, nerve signal transmission, protein synthesis, and cell division. The remaining waste products \u2014 carbon dioxide and water \u2014 are removed from the body through exhalation, urination, and perspiration.<\/p>\n\n\n\n<p>This process is much more efficient than anaerobic respiration because it produces more ATP per glucose molecule. While anaerobic respiration yields only 2 ATP molecules per glucose, aerobic respiration typically produces around 36 to 38 ATP molecules.<\/p>\n\n\n\n<p>In summary, aerobic respiration is vital for life as it supplies the energy that living organisms need for growth, movement, and other daily functions.<\/p>\n\n\n\n<figure class=\"wp-block-image size-full\"><img loading=\"lazy\" decoding=\"async\" width=\"852\" height=\"1024\" src=\"https:\/\/gaviki.com\/blog\/wp-content\/uploads\/2025\/06\/learnexams-banner8-1047.jpeg\" alt=\"\" class=\"wp-image-38628\" srcset=\"https:\/\/gaviki.com\/blog\/wp-content\/uploads\/2025\/06\/learnexams-banner8-1047.jpeg 852w, https:\/\/gaviki.com\/blog\/wp-content\/uploads\/2025\/06\/learnexams-banner8-1047-250x300.jpeg 250w, https:\/\/gaviki.com\/blog\/wp-content\/uploads\/2025\/06\/learnexams-banner8-1047-768x923.jpeg 768w\" sizes=\"auto, (max-width: 852px) 100vw, 852px\" \/><\/figure>\n","protected":false},"excerpt":{"rendered":"<p>What is meant by aerobic respiration?
